温暖白开水

文章
2
资源
0
加入时间
3年0月21天

【笔记】Node.js概述和开发环境搭建一、Node.js简介二、部署Node.js开发环境

文章目录一、Node.js简介1.简介2.发展历史3.Node.js的结构4.Node.js的特点事件驱动优点异步、非阻塞I/O单线程5.Node.js的缺点(1)不适合CPU计算密集型应用(2)只支持单核CPU,不能充分利用CPU(3)内存控制不足且容量有限制(4)可靠性低(5)其他6.Node.js的应用场景REST/JSON APIs统一Web应用的UI层大量Ajax请求的应用二、部署Node.js开发环境1.Windows10下(1)下载(2)安装及验证(3)环境变量配置2.Linux下

Modbus Slave缓冲区溢出漏洞CVE-2022-1068分析与复现

异或的源数据是poc中字符串按两位一组转化为十六进制的值,异或的KEY为“97280132”,比如第一轮循环时,将poc中的前两位字符串“AA”转换为0xAA,然后与KEY的第一位字符“9”,十六进制为0x39进行异或,最后将异或的结果放到栈中缓冲区MultiByteStr[v52]进行保存,如果poc中的字符串个数大于600个字符(600=300*2,poc中为736个字符“A”),将发生栈溢出,可以覆盖栈中SEH地址,函数返回地址和局部变量等,导致程序崩溃。